JOB DESCRIPTION AND POSITION REQUIREMENTS:

Penn State is currently seeking an Assistant Director of Stewardship (Stewardship Officer) in supporting Penn State Behrend, a commonwealth campus located in Erie, PA. As a member of the Division of Development and Alumni Relations, you can play an integral role in Penn State's future and contribute to one of the most successful fundraising and alumni relations operations in the country. This position reports to Penn State Behrend's Director of Development and works in coordination with various departments throughout the University.

The Assistant Director of Stewardship is responsible for developing and maintaining the comprehensive stewardship process for Penn State Behrend's Development and Alumni Relations team including administering unit software access and compliance and developing proper acknowledgment procedures for donors. This position also provides the primary financial oversight for the unit's various budgets.

This position requires a bachelor's degree or higher plus one year of experience, or an equivalent combination of education and experience. The successful candidate will have:

  • ability to work in a fast-paced, confidential environment
  • work with and/or learn multiple software systems
  • general accounting and budgeting knowledge
  • strong written and proofreading skills
  • organization skills and have attention to detail
  • exemplary interpersonal and communication skills with both internal and external constituents
  • ability to self-motivate and work both independently and as part of a team
  • demonstrated commitment to diversity, equity, and inclusion
  • commitment to professional development, learning, and being mentored

Operation of a motor vehicle as part of the position's duties and a valid driver's license are required. Successful completion of a motor vehicle records check, in addition to standard background checks, is also required.
